The reason Carmack makes engines that require such insane systems at their release is partially because he knows that the engine is going to be around for a long time and hardware will catch up. I mean, look at the Q3 engine for example. That's been licensed for tons of games because Carmack is an engine god. He designed it with a long-term future in mind and it shows.

BTW, the leaked alpha is just that, an alpha. Speed optimizations are one of the last things done to an engine. Consider that when calling it slow.
